Understanding Freestyle Libre and Its Benefits
The Freestyle Libre is a continuous glucose monitoring (CGM) system designed for individuals with diabetes, but its benefits extend far beyond that demographic. For fitness enthusiasts, understanding glucose levels can be a game-changer. Here are some of the benefits:
- Real-Time Monitoring: The device provides continuous data about your glucose levels, enabling you to make informed decisions about your workouts.
- Performance Optimization: By understanding how different exercises affect your glucose levels, you can tailor your workouts for optimal performance.
- Health Insights: Monitoring glucose levels can help identify patterns that may affect your health, guiding you towards better dietary and exercise choices.
Integrating Freestyle Libre Into Your Workout Routine
To get the most out of the Freestyle Libre, it’s important to know how to integrate it into your fitness routine effectively. Here’s a step-by-step guide:
Step 1: Set Up Your Freestyle Libre
Before you start your workout routine, make sure your Freestyle Libre is set up correctly:
- Clean the area on your upper arm where you will apply the sensor.
- Follow the instructions provided to apply the sensor securely.
- Use the reader or your smartphone to scan the sensor and check your initial glucose levels.
Step 2: Plan Your Workout Based on Glucose Levels
Understanding your glucose levels before a workout can help you optimize your performance:
- If your levels are low (<70 mg/dL), consider having a quick snack before exercising.
- If your levels are high (>180 mg/dL), consider lower-intensity workouts to avoid complications.
- Monitor your levels throughout your workout to ensure they stay within a healthy range.
Step 3: Choose the Right Type of Exercise
Different exercises can affect your glucose levels in various ways:
- Aerobic Exercise: Activities like running, cycling, or swimming can lower blood glucose levels, making them great for overall fitness.
- Strength Training: Lifting weights can temporarily increase glucose levels but is effective for building muscle and improving metabolism.
- High-Intensity Interval Training (HIIT): This can vary greatly in its effect on glucose levels; monitor closely to see how your body responds.
Step 4: Post-Workout Monitoring
Post-exercise glucose monitoring is just as important:
- Check your glucose levels after your workout to understand how your body has reacted.
- Adjust your post-workout nutrition based on your glucose levels to aid recovery and maintain energy.
- Use the data to inform future workouts and nutrition choices.

Troubleshooting Common Issues
While the Freestyle Libre is a powerful tool, users may encounter some common issues. Here are troubleshooting tips:
- Sensor Adhesion: If the sensor does not stick well, ensure the skin is clean and dry before application. Consider using adhesive patches for additional support.
- Inaccurate Readings: If you suspect inaccurate readings, re-scan the sensor and ensure it is functioning correctly. Consult the user manual for troubleshooting guidance.
- Skin Irritation: Some users may experience irritation. If this occurs, remove the sensor and consult a healthcare professional.
